Congratulations to both Mark Soo (02) and Kathy Slade, Gallery Assistant-READ Bookstore, for their recent VIVA Award wins. The awards, provided by the Jack and Doris Shadbolt Foundation, are awarded annually to celebrate achievement by BC artists in mid-career.

Mark Soo, a photographer and multi-media artist, has exhibited in international exhibitions in Manchester, Melbourne, New York and Toronto. In 2006 he was the focus of a solo exhibition at Vancouver's Artspeak Gallery and in 2008 Mark's photo-based artwork, That's That's Alright Alright Mama Mama, was the first work selected for purchase by the Vancouver Art Gallery for its Audain Emerging Artists Acquisition Fund.

Kathy Slade mixes both high and low culture in a practice that includes video, photography, embroidery and sculpture. Kathy has exhibited her work across Canada and internationally, including China, Ireland, Sweden and the United States. She is currently exhibiting Black Pom-pom, an enormous pom-pom displayed on the gallery floor, as part of the exhibition How Soon Is Now.
